Understanding Rivotril's Uses and Effects

Rivotril, a prescription, is utilized to manage symptoms associated with anxiety. It belongs to the group of medications known as benzodiazepines. These compounds exert their effect by increasing the activity of g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A), a neurotransmitter in the brain that encourages relaxation and reduces neuronal excitability. Rivotril is typically prescribed for short-term use due to the potential for addiction.

  • Common side effects of Rivotril include drowsiness, dizziness, and impaired coordination.
  • It's crucial to discuss a healthcare professional before using Rivotril, as it may interact with other medications or underlying health conditions.
  • Dosage and duration of treatment should be carefully observed by a doctor to minimize the risk of adverse effects.

Benzo Drugs

Benzodiazepines are a class of medications commonly administered to manage anxiety disorders and insomnia. They function by enhancing the effects of g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A), a neurotransmitter in the brain that has relaxing properties. While benzodiazepines can be effective in the short term, they also carry potential risks.

Potential risk of benzodiazepine use is addiction. Long-term use can lead to tolerance, meaning higher doses are required to achieve the same results. This can increase the risk of dependence and withdrawal symptoms when the medication is discontinued.

  • A different concern is the potential for interactions with other medications or substances, including alcohol.
  • Moreover, benzodiazepines can slow down cognitive function and coordination, making it dangerous to operate machinery or drive a vehicle.

It's crucial to use benzodiazepines only as instructed by a healthcare professional. They can help you assess the potential benefits and dangers and determine if these medications are suitable for your individual needs.
